What Are Recurrent Gum Infections?

Gum infections, also known as gingivitis, occur when bacteria accumulate around the gum line, causing inflammation of the soft tissues surrounding the teeth.

When these infections continue to return despite treatment, they are referred to as recurrent gum infections, often indicating that the underlying cause has not been fully addressed.

Common Symptoms of Recurrent Gum Infections

  • Red, swollen gums
  • Bleeding during brushing or flossing
  • Persistent bad breath
  • Gum tenderness or pain
  • Receding gums
  • Sensitivity around the gum line
  • Unpleasant taste in the mouth

Can Mouthwash Treat Recurrent Gum Infections?

The short answer is:

No, mouthwash alone cannot completely treat recurrent gum infections.

However, it can be a valuable part of a comprehensive treatment plan by:

  • Reducing bacterial growth
  • Controlling plaque accumulation
  • Freshening breath
  • Supporting gum healing

In many cases, recurrent gum infections are caused by plaque and tartar buildup that require professional dental treatment.

How Does Mouthwash Help with Gum Inflammation?

1. Reduces Harmful Bacteria

Many therapeutic mouthwashes contain antibacterial ingredients that help lower the number of harmful microorganisms in the mouth.

2. Helps Control Inflammation

Certain medicated rinses are designed to soothe inflamed gum tissues and reduce swelling.

3. Improves Breath Odor

By reducing bacterial activity, mouthwash can help eliminate chronic bad breath associated with gum disease.

4. Reaches Difficult Areas

Mouthwash can access areas that are sometimes difficult to clean with a toothbrush alone.

When Is Mouthwash Not Enough?

Mouthwash should not be considered a standalone treatment in the following situations:

ConditionIs Mouthwash Enough?
Mild gingivitisMay help significantly
Heavy tartar buildupNo
Periodontal diseaseNo
Deep gum pocketsNo
Persistent bleeding gumsNo
Advanced gum recessionNo

These conditions typically require professional intervention from a dentist or periodontist.

Why Do Gum Infections Keep Coming Back?

Poor Oral Hygiene

Inadequate brushing and flossing allow plaque to accumulate continuously.

Tartar Buildup

Over time, plaque hardens into tartar, which cannot be removed by brushing alone.

Smoking

Smoking significantly increases the risk of chronic gum disease and delays healing.

Diabetes

Poorly controlled diabetes can make gum infections more frequent and difficult to manage.

Hormonal Changes

Pregnancy, puberty, and menopause can affect gum health.

Vitamin Deficiencies

A lack of essential nutrients, especially Vitamin C, may contribute to gum inflammation.

Dry Mouth

Reduced saliva flow allows bacteria to multiply more easily.

Best Types of Mouthwash for Gum Infections

Chlorhexidine Mouthwash

Chlorhexidine is one of the most effective antibacterial mouthwashes available.

Benefits

  • Significantly reduces bacteria
  • Helps decrease gum inflammation
  • Reduces bleeding

Limitations

  • Can cause temporary tooth staining
  • Should only be used under professional supervision for limited periods

Essential Oil Mouthwash

These mouthwashes help reduce bacteria and improve overall oral health.

Fluoride Mouthwash

While beneficial for cavity prevention, fluoride rinses are not the primary treatment for gum disease.

Can You Use Mouthwash Every Day?

The answer depends on the type of mouthwash:

Mouthwash TypeDaily Use
Fluoride mouthwashYes
Essential oil mouthwashUsually yes
Chlorhexidine mouthwashShort-term use only
Prescription mouthwashAs directed by your dentist

The Most Effective Treatment for Recurrent Gum Infections

1. Professional Dental Cleaning

Removing plaque and tartar is the foundation of successful treatment.

2. Periodontal Therapy

Patients with deeper infections may require specialized gum treatments.

3. Appropriate Mouthwash

A dentist may recommend a specific therapeutic rinse based on your condition.

4. Improved Home Care

Maintain a consistent oral hygiene routine:

  • Brush twice daily
  • Floss every day
  • Clean the tongue regularly

5. Regular Dental Checkups

Professional examinations every six months help prevent recurrence.

How to Prevent Gum Infections from Returning

  • Brush thoroughly twice a day
  • Use dental floss daily
  • Drink plenty of water
  • Quit smoking
  • Reduce sugary foods and beverages
  • Manage chronic health conditions
  • Schedule routine professional cleanings

When Should You See a Dentist Immediately?

Seek professional dental care if you experience:

  • Persistent gum bleeding
  • Pus around the gums
  • Loose teeth
  • Significant gum recession
  • Severe pain or swelling
